Plural is أُولِي أَجْنِحَةٍ اَجْنِحَةٌ : Possessors of wings )352( آنَا فِي جَنَاحٍ فُلان : I am under the protection of such a one. هُوَ مَقْصُوْصُ الْجَنَاحِ : His wings are clipped i. e. he lacks power, strength or ability; he is impotent. رَكِبُوا جَنَاحَيِ الطَّائِرِ : They left their homes or country or accustomed places. نَحْنُ عَلَى جَنَاحِ السَّفَرِ : We are upon the wings of travel; we are about to travel. جُنَاحٌ : A in a crime or an act of disobedience, or an inclination to it; and anxiety or molestation or hurt which one is made to; a blame to bear. لَيْسَ عَلَيْكُمْ جُنَاحٌ : There shall be no sin (or blame) upon you (2:237). ]aor. يَجْنُدُ inf. noun جُنُودٌ[ : He collected جُنُودٌ ie armies military forces etc. جُنْدٌ )plural( )جُنُودٌ an army; a military force; a legion; a body of troops or soldiers; auxiliaries; any species of creatures; إِنَّهُمْ جُنْدٌ مُّغْرَقُوْنَ : Surely, they are a host who will be drowned )44:25( وَلِلهِ جُنُودُ السَّمَوَاتِ : And for Allah are the hosts of the heavens and the earth )48:8( جُندٌ = a city province or district; military capital. اَجْنَادُ الشَّامِ )plural): Military capitals of Syria. جَنَفَ ]aor. يَجْنِفُ inf. noun جُنُوفًا [ and جَنِفَ ]aor. يَجْنَفُ inf. noun جَنَفَ [ جَنْفًا عَنِ الطَّرِيقِ : He deviated from the right path. جَنِفَ فَيْ وَصِيَّتِهِ : He acted wrongfully in his will. جَنفَ or جَنِفَ : He acted wrongfully or unjustly; he deviated from the right way or course; he inclined to sin; he kept away from rightful things. تَجَانَفَ فِي مَشْيِهِ : He inclined on one side in a proud manner; تَجَانَفَ إِلَى الشَّيْءِ : He intentionally inclined to a thing تَجَانَفَ أَهْلَهُ : He kept away from his family on account of hatred تَجَانَفَ لِإِثْمِ : He inclined to a sin or affected an inclining جَنَفٌ : Inclining to sin etc; deviating from the right way or course; acting wrongfully or unjustly; keeping away from a good thing. جَنَفٌ also means depression in one of the two sides of the chest with evenness of the other side. مَنْ خَافَ مِنْ مُّوْصٍ جَنَفًا : He who fears on the part of the testator an inclination to a wrong course or deviation from the right course or acting unjustly )2:183( غَيْرَ مُتَجَانِفٍ ِلإِثْمِ : Without being deliberately inclined towards sin (5:4). 149
